Disparities in Heart Transplantation Allocation and Outcomes by Blood Type in Korea (2010-2022).

Abstract

BACKGROUND AND OBJECTIVES

This study aimed to elucidate the influence of recipient blood type on heart transplant allocation dynamics in Korea, focusing on donor matching, wait times, and post-transplant survival from 2010 to 2022.

METHODS

In this retrospective cohort study, we examined 1,745 heart transplant recipients classified by blood types: A (n=631), B (n=488), AB (n=256), and O (n=370). Parameters studied encompassed donor and recipient ages, donor blood type compatibility, organ type, emergency status, waiting periods, and survival rates up to one year post-transplant.

RESULTS

This investigation revealed significant disparities in the outcomes for heart transplant waitlist patients, differentiated by blood type. O recipients encountered notably extended median wait times of 110 days (an average of 300±514 days), which is substantially longer compared to A (65 days), B (58 days), and AB (29 days). Furthermore, the mortality rate for O recipients while on the waitlist was markedly high at 78.1%, in contrast to 75.2% for A, 72.3% for B, and 48.5% for AB. O recipients who, despite constituting a significant proportion of the donor pool (34.1%), received transplants at disproportionately lower rates.

CONCLUSIONS

Type O heart transplant recipients in Korea face significant challenges, including higher mortality rates during the waiting period and frequent necessity for left ventricular assist device interventions. Urgent policy reforms are needed to address these disparities and improve equitable organ allocation for blood type O patients.

摘要

背景与目的

本研究旨在阐明受者血型对韩国心脏移植分配动态的影响,重点关注2010年至2022年期间的供体匹配、等待时间和移植后生存率。

方法

在这项回顾性队列研究中,我们检查了1745名按血型分类的心脏移植受者:A型(n = 631)、B型(n = 488)、AB型(n = 256)和O型(n = 370)。研究参数包括供体和受者年龄、供体血型相容性、器官类型、紧急状态、等待期以及移植后一年的生存率。

结果

这项调查揭示了心脏移植等待名单上患者的结果因血型而异,存在显著差异。O型受者的中位等待时间明显延长,为110天(平均300±514天),与A型(65天)、B型(58天)和AB型(29天)相比长得多。此外,O型受者在等待名单上的死亡率明显较高,为78.1%,而A型为75.2%,B型为72.3%,AB型为48.5%。尽管O型受者在供体库中占很大比例(34.1%),但其接受移植的比例却出奇地低。

结论

韩国O型心脏移植受者面临重大挑战,包括等待期间较高的死亡率以及频繁需要进行左心室辅助装置干预。需要紧急进行政策改革,以解决这些差异,改善O型血患者的公平器官分配。
